Personal data Arie Klarenbeek 

  • He was born about 1839 in Hilversum.
  • He died on January 29, 1903 in Hilversum.Source 1
    Overledene Arie Klarenbeek Geboorteplaats Hilversum Geslacht Man Leeftijd 64 Vader Jacob Klarenbeek Moeder Elisabeth van Gemert Weduwnaar Geertruida van Raaij Gebeurtenis Overlijden Datum 29-1-1903 Gebeurtenisplaats Hilversum Documenttype BS Overlijden Erfgoedinstelling Noord-Hollands Archief Plaats instelling Haarlem Collectiegebied Noord-Holland Aktenummer 37 Registratiedatum 29-1-1903 Akteplaats Hilversum
  • A child of Jacob Klarenbeek and Elisabeth van Gemert
  • This information was last updated on April 5, 2017.

Household of Arie Klarenbeek

He is married to Geertruida van Raaij.

They got married on May 18, 1864 at Hilversum.Source 1

Bruidegom Arie Klarenbeek Beroep Wever Geboorteplaats Hilversum Leeftijd 25 Bruid Geertruida van Raaij Geboorteplaats Hilversum Leeftijd 26 Vader van de bruidegom Jacob Klarenbeek Moeder van de bruidegom Elisabeth van Gemert Beroep werkster Vader van de bruid Willem van Raaij Beroep daghuurder Moeder van de bruid Mietje Smorenburg Gebeurtenis Huwelijk Datum 18-05-1864 Gebeurtenisplaats Hilversum Documenttype BS Huwelijk Erfgoedinstelling Noord-Hollands Archief Plaats instellingHaarlem Collectiegebied Noord-Holland Aktenummer 25 Registratiedatum 18-05-1864 Akteplaats Hilversum Aktesoort H

Child(ren):

  1. Mietje Klarenbeek  ± 1865-1866
  2. Jaap Klarenbeek  ± 1869-1871
  3. Mietje Klarenbeek  ± 1872-1872
  4. Jacob Klarenbeek  ± 1876-1947
